When I first signed up with google voice I needed a verifying phone number so I gave them my home number.  My goal is to eliminate the phone company.  But now I can't receive a phone call on my forwarding home phone without it being plugged into the phone company system. It won't let me change my home phone number, plus you can't use a google number as a forwarding number.  I'm not a stupid person, but I don't get it. Any help appreciated.

RonR

I assume you're trying to use Google Voice with an OBi.  If so, you normally don't have Google Voice forward your calls to another phone.  You normally select Google Chat as your only forwarding phone on Google Voice.  If you don't have a Google Chat phone listed on Google Voice, you must make at least one outgoing phone call from your Gmail account to create it.

With Google Chat selected as your only forwarding phone, you then configure the OBi for Google Voice on SP1/ITSPA and your off and running.

jimates

Raven,

You must have one forwarding phone listed in your google voice account. So, if you only have one phone listed, and you terminate your home phone service, you can't delete that number from the account. You can either change it (new number verification needed by google voice), or you can just uncheck it as a forwarding number and leave it in the account unused.

as RonR stated, add the google chat as a forwarding phone and use it by itself to ring the Obi.

Hi Thanx for the replies....  When I try to call the google number it goes to voice mail every time no matter what I try...  I'm still lost.   

RonR

Can you successfully reach the echo test by dialing **9 222 222 222?  No configuration of the OBi is required for this to work.  If you cannot reach the echo test, your OBi is not comminicating properly with the Internet.

If you can reach the echo test, log into the OBi at the IP address returned by dialing ***1 and confirm that your OBi is configured with the follwoing settings (all other settings can be at Default):


Service Providers -> ITSP Profile A -> General -> Name : Google Voice
Service Providers -> ITSP Profile A -> General -> SignalingProtocol : Google Voice

Voice Services -> SP1 Service -> AuthUserName : (Google Voice username)
Voice Services -> SP1 Service -> AuthPassword : (Google Voice password)
Voice Services -> SP1 Service -> X_SkipCallScreening : (checked)

Physical Interfaces -> PHONE Port -> PrimaryLine : SP1 Service

Does Status -> System Status -> SP1 Service Status -> Status show Connected?  If so, you should be able to call your Google Voice number from a non-OBi telephone and have the OBi phone ring and be able to answer the incoming call.
